Taxonomic Classification

Rank Crab-eating Mongoose Thwaites's Nut Truffle
Kingdom Animalia (Animals) Fungi (Fungi)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Basidiomycota (Club Fungi)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ms)
Order Carnivora (Carnivorans) Agaricales (Gilled Mushrooms)
Family Herpestidae Hymenogastraceae
Genus Herpestes Hymenogaster
Species Herpestes urva Hymenogaster thwaitesii
